How It All Started

For as long as I can remember, I’ve been drawn to creativity. As a kid, I was always sketching, doodling, or playing with art sets. There was something about turning a blank page into something full of life and expression. Then, as I got older and discovered graffiti, my world changed. It was bold, raw, and unapologetic—art that didn’t just exist quietly but demanded to be seen. That’s when I really fell in love with visual storytelling and the power it has to make an impact.

But like a lot of us, life pulled me in a different direction. For years, I worked as an HVAC technician in New Jersey. It was honest work, and I was good at it—solving problems, helping people, and keeping systems running. But something was missing. Every day, I’d go to work feeling like I was leaving a big part of myself behind.

Eventually, I couldn’t ignore the pull toward creativity anymore. I didn’t know exactly where to start, but I knew I had to try. So, I began teaching myself graphic design, branding, and web design in every spare moment I had. My days were spent working HVAC, and my nights and early mornings were filled with YouTube tutorials, LinkedIn Learning classes, and pretty much becoming obsessed with the Made by James courses. Honestly? It was exhausting. But it also gave me purpose.

Over time, I started gaining traction. I got my first opportunities—first at a branding agency and later as an in-house designer. Those roles challenged me in ways I couldn’t have imagined. I learned how to adapt, solve creative problems, and bring ideas to life. They showed me what it takes to create brands and designs that truly resonate with people.

Now, I’m proud to say I’ve made it to a place I once only dreamed of. I’m working full-time as a graphic designer, doing what I love every day. But here’s the thing: I’m still on this journey. I still have so much more to learn and so many ways to grow. And honestly, that’s what excites me the most.

This whole experience has taught me that life isn’t about reaching a final destination—it’s about the process. It’s about showing up every day, facing the challenges, and finding joy in the growth.

So, if you’re chasing your own dream, I hope my story reminds you that it’s okay to take it one step at a time. I’m not done yet, and I don’t think I ever will be. There’s always more to discover, create, and share.
